In the Powell & Lewis Center (43035, 43065) rental market, 2-bedroom condos/townhomes surged 3.9% month-over-month to a median rent of $1,710 in April 2026. This segment exhibited the sharpest monthly growth among all property types for 2BR units, outpacing apartments and single-family alternatives by at least $94.

Single-family homes in Powell & Lewis Center (43035, 43065) led the 3-bedroom segment, with a median rent of $2,472—$438 higher than apartments and $141 above condos/townhomes. The monthly increase for single-family 3BRs stood at 2.2%, underscoring their premium positioning within larger unit categories.

Among all categories, Powell & Lewis Center (43035, 43065) rental trends indicate 1-bedroom apartments experienced the steepest month-over-month decline, dropping 3.1% to $1,342. This downward movement contrasts with gains shown by 1BR condos/townhomes, which rose 0.05%, and 1BR single-family homes, up 0.67% over the same period.
